Skip to content

Commit 3246153

Browse files
authored
Merge pull request #1412 from diggerhq/fix/cors-middleware
fix cors middleware
2 parents 8425ee2 + 35a11d1 commit 3246153

File tree

1 file changed

+5
-7
lines changed

1 file changed

+5
-7
lines changed

backend/main.go

Lines changed: 5 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-173,17 +173,15 @@ func main() {
173173

174174
admin.POST("/tokens/issue-access-token", controllers.IssueAccessTokenForOrg)
175175

176-
apiGroup := r.Group("/api")
177-
apiGroup.Use(middleware.CORSMiddleware())
178-
179-
projectsApiGroup := apiGroup.Group("/projects")
180-
projectsApiGroup.Use(middleware.GetWebMiddleware())
176+
r.Use(middleware.CORSMiddleware())
177+
projectsApiGroup := r.Group("/api/projects")
178+
projectsApiGroup.Use(middleware.GetApiMiddleware())
181179
projectsApiGroup.GET("/", controllers.FindProjectsForOrg)
182180
projectsApiGroup.GET("/:project_id", controllers.ProjectDetails)
183181
projectsApiGroup.GET("/:project_id/runs", controllers.RunsForProject)
184182

185-
runsApiGroup := apiGroup.Group("/runs")
186-
runsApiGroup.Use(middleware.GetWebMiddleware())
183+
runsApiGroup := r.Group("/api/runs")
184+
runsApiGroup.Use(middleware.CORSMiddleware(), middleware.GetApiMiddleware())
187185
runsApiGroup.GET("/:run_id", controllers.RunDetails)
188186
runsApiGroup.POST("/:run_id/approve", controllers.ApproveRun)
189187

0 commit comments

Comments
 (0)